Template:Infobox:Fauna Flora The Spinefish is a life form belonging to the Fauna category and a relative of the Hoopfish.
Spinefish are cathemeral and easy to catch, as they do not retreat from the player and are bioluminescent. Since the H2.0 update, they are have been able to be cooked.
In the future it may spawn in the Lost River[1].
Appearance
The Spinefish is a small and slim fish that is slightly smaller than other common fish like Peepers and Airsacks. The Spinefish is a transparent grey-green color that is more opaque at its head and tail. It has two bright green eyes with red markings and a small fin on its back. Its body is transparent with light blue stripes and a grey cord running through the middle. The Spinefish's most distinct feature is a transparent grey hoop that extends from the top and bottom of its head and bends around its tail. Its red tail extends beyond the hoop.
